Output 93a66daf706d59b07d4dcf1490e128578e6e536cb3ba866830834acac8083a0a:1

value
13212000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589627529daa21ba996cc4c639a0a9f23be85f6f OP_EQUAL
address
39mRGHCiiiGajxfUaMdYwRzC9emjkiDN9o
transaction
93a66daf706d59b07d4dcf1490e128578e6e536cb3ba866830834acac8083a0a
spent
true